Colón continues its preparations to host Patronato this Saturday for Matchday 25 of the Primera Nacional. The coaching staff is closely monitoring the progress of some players and is beginning to define the team that will start at the Brigadier General Estanislao López.
One of the main developments is in attack. Alan Bonansea would not be fit in time, so Leandro Garate would once again take the center-forward spot. The striker is already training alongside his teammates and is shaping up once again as the team’s main attacking reference.
Meanwhile, the coaching staff is also keeping a close eye on the situation of Darío Sarmiento, who is dealing with an ankle injury. His progress in the upcoming training sessions will be decisive in determining whether he can be considered for the clash against the Entre Ríos side.
Another piece of good news for Colón is that Emanuel Beltrán would be available and could return to the squad.
The match against Patronato will be this Saturday at the Brigadier General Estanislao López stadium, for Matchday 25 of the Primera Nacional. Fabricio Llobet will be the referee for an important match for the Sabalero, who will look to make the most of home advantage and pick up points in the decisive stretch of the championship.
